Our Learning and Reading Specialists are educators who are skilled and experienced in providing learning strategies to students who are currently performing either slightly below, or well below, grade level expectations in a specific subject area. A specialist then provides strategic support to help students meet grade-level standards in reading, writing, math, or executive functioning.
These educators work one-on-one with students or in small groups, both in and outside of the classroom, to give students support that meets their individual needs. Specialists also work closely with classroom teachers to either assist with, or model, ways to adjust the content, process, and products of their lessons (differentiation), to help all students achieve success.
